Juniper Square entered their AI journey with clear ambition but a familiar challenge: fragmented adoption, uneven confidence across teams, and no scalable way to build a consistent foundation. As a fast-growing tech company with employees spanning multiple continents, they needed more than enthusiasm — they needed a structured, repeatable approach.
"We were already pushing hard on AI internally — incorporating it into performance competencies and messaging to employees that their performance would be evaluated against it," said Vittoria Reimers, SVP of People. "But we needed something scalable. The peer-to-peer learning we'd built was great, but it was hard to scale."
Juniper Square and Clarinet built a structured and scalable ecosystem for AI adoption around four strategic engagements:
To make adoption stick, AI couldn't be an "extra" task—it had to be part of the job description. Clarinet helped Juniper Square integrate AI competencies directly into the organizational DNA, from hiring for a growth mindset to reinforcing AI-driven behaviors through performance frameworks.
AI training is strategically timed 30–60 days into a new hire’s tenure—the "sweet spot" where they understand their role but haven't yet hardened their habits. By facilitating monthly sessions focused on real-world work situations, Clarinet ensures every new employee reaches a baseline fluency that transforms AI from a novelty into a standard operating procedure.
To move from AI interest to execution, 60+ managers participated in a change management intensive designed to connect AI directly to their departmental goals. This wasn't a "sit and listen" session; it was a catalyst for functional ownership.
Clarinet worked with the People Team to begin to dismantle and rebuild core processes from scratch. 4,000+ hours of annual time savings were identified to help the team define their automation roadmap.
